No room for bribery – MDF boss rejects plea for arrested illegal miners
Administrator of the Minerals Development Fund (MDF), Dr. Hannah Louisa Bissiw-Kotei, has firmly rejected attempts by an unnamed individual to intervene on behalf of arrested illegal miners, stating that no amount of influence or bribery will stop the law from taking its course. Illegal Mining Syndicate Uncovered in PNG ; Eight Foreigners Arrested and to be Deported
Eight Chinese nationals are set to be deported after being caught in an illegal alluvial mining scheme involving industrial machinery in a remote area straddling the East and West Sepik provinces in Papua New Guinea.Their arrest came as a result of a collaborative operation by the PNG Immigration Office and East Sepik Provincial Administration, according to officials.
